  • Collector’s Guide: Grimer (Team Rocket #57)

    Collector’s Guide: Grimer (Team Rocket #57)

    Grimer (Team Rocket 57) Collector’s Guide

    Quick Facts

    Grimer from the Team Rocket set is a Basic Pokémon card with 40 HP, illustrated by Kagemaru Himeno. It features two attacks: Poison Gas, which puts the Defending Pokémon to sleep, and Sticky Hands, which can deal variable damage and potentially paralyze the opponent. This card is classified as Common and has a Grass type with a Psychic weakness (×2). Its retreat cost is 1, and it has no abilities or resistances. The card’s flavor text notes that Grimers are formed in waste-processing plants and can infiltrate towns through sewers.
